The American Society of Civil Engineers, founded in 1852, is the oldest of the professional engineering societies. Admission to ASCE is international recognition of dedication to the civil engineering profession, with definite advantages.

Why should you join ASCE?

  • Activities
    • Active participation and success in the annual Concrete Canoe and Steel Bridge competitions.
    • Involvement with community service projects such as Habitat for Humanity and Adopt-a-Highway.
    • Mentor programs both on the student to student and professional engineer to student levels.
    • Meeting every other Thursday night with professional speakers covering the entire range of civil engineering.
    • Numerous social activities including social hour after meetings, tailgate parties, the holiday party, and the spring picnic.
    • Numerous fund raising projects.
    • Joint meetings with the Madison Branch of ASCE
    • Field trips to construction jobs.
  • Benefits
    • Access to the ASCE exam file.
    • Opportunity to receive scholarships sponsored by ASCE
    • Opportunity to meet civil engineering professionals.
    • Discounts for most ASCE specialty conferences and conventions.
    • Opportunity to become an officer and assume a leadership role.
